INTAKT is a state-of-the-art sampler specifically designed for rhythmic loop playback, manipulation, and mayhem. INTAKT’s convenient one-screen interface features tremendous sound shaping abilities without disrupting the creative flow. Using multiple algorithms, INTAKT automatically syncs to tempo, while an outstanding library of loops from Zero-G and East West provides sample source material for nearly any musical style. Naturally, INTAKT provides a wealth of sound shaping options, including a first-class multimode filter, an envelope follower, two LFOs, effects, and more.
* Based on the Kontakt sampling engine -- up to 128 stereo voices, professional sound quality with 32 bit processing, up to 96 kHz sample rate support. * Three sampler-modes: Beat Machine with ISE (Individual Slice Edit), Time Machine and Sampler mode. * Easy synchronization of loops to MIDI tempo. * Modulation section provides AHDSR envelope, two individual LFOs, envelope follower and a DBD pitch envelope. * Integrated effects: Group filter including low-pass, high-pass, band-reject or band-pass modes, global filter, lo-fi, distortion, delay. * Easy and intuitive user interface and file browser. * MIDI file export. * Total Recall. * Includes an 1.2 gigabyte loop library by Zero-G and East West.

Introducing Paax 2, a powerful VST sampler that matches many of the features of expensive samplers.
Paax 2 Features
* Up to 128 presets per bank. * Up to 84 splits per preset and 8 dual velocity-layers (16 samples) per split. * 128 simultaneous voices*. * Plays 8/16/24/32 bit**, mono/stereo wav files @ any sample rate. * Low CPU consumption. * RAM save scheme (only active presets’ samples are loaded at one time). * Low aliasing resampling technology, 32 bit audio engine. * 3 envelope controls (DAHDSR) per preset: amplitude, pitch and filter cutoff. * 3 configurable LFOs per preset: tremolo, vibrato and filter cutoff with optional delay. * All envelopes and oscillators can be synchronized to MIDI tempo. * New Micro-Granular pitch-shifting option for transposing sounds without affecting duration/timbre. * New bank format offers choice for embedded or referenced samples. * Capable of importing SoundFonts (.sf2) and AKAI S5000/6000 programs (.akp) * Fully automatable. * VST 2.3 compatible.

The BallSequencer is a sequencer based around the idea of midinotes generated by balls moving around inside a rectangular area. Notes are triggered whenever a ball collides with the boundary of the rectangle. You can set parameters that will control the movement of each ball, in addition to possible note and velocity values.
This probably sounds like a complicated way of making random-sounding bursts of sound, but in practice I have found it very useful for creating pleasing rhytmical patterns and melodies. The interface makes it very easy to drastically change the rhytmical quality of a sequence, unlike in a traditional sequencer. Of course, it's also fully capable of creating crazy and uncohesive patterns if that's your thing
You can have 1-6 balls bouncing around in the rectangle at any time, each ball has it's own horisontal parameter strip, and an associated color.
Dream Sequencer is for that sequencing sound of the 70's as produced by Tangerine Dream etc. The VSTi synchronizes with the host bpm and takes its root key from a "midi note" and plays for the duration from "note on" until "note off". The pitch knobs are quantized to semitones with a range of one octave.
